86018-07-7 - Physico-chemical Properties
Molecular Formula | C15H35N3
|
Molar Mass | 257.46 |
Density | 0.857g/mLat 25°C(lit.) |
Boling Point | 332.9°C at 760 mmHg |
Flash Point | >230°F |
Vapor Presure | 0.000142mmHg at 25°C |
Refractive Index | n20/D 1.462(lit.) |
86018-07-7 - Risk and Safety
Hazard Symbols | C - Corrosive
|
Risk Codes | 34 - Causes burns
|
Safety Description | S26 - In case of contact with eyes, rinse immediately with plenty of water and seek medical advice.
S27 - Take off immediately all contaminated clothing.
S36/37/39 - Wear suitable protective clothing, gloves and eye/face protection.
S45 - In case of accident or if you feel unwell, seek medical advice immediately (show the label whenever possible.)
|
UN IDs | UN 2735 8/PG 3 |
WGK Germany | 3 |
